On Tuesday, Bajaj Finance shares experienced a dip ahead of the eagerly anticipated Q4 financial results, scheduled for release today. The stock initially opened at ₹9,149.70 but later fell by 1.44%, reaching ₹8,960.80 on the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E). Investors are keen to see how the company’s earnings for the fourth quarter of FY25, set to be announced on April 29, will unfold, alongside discussions about a potential special dividend, stock split, and bonus share issuance.
Anticipated Earnings Performance
Bajaj Finance, a prominent player in the non-banking financial company (NBFC) sector, is predicted to showcase robust earnings for the quarter ending March 2025. Analysts anticipate that the company will benefit from:
- Strong loan growth
- Stable credit costs
- Enhanced asset quality
Net Profit Projections
The financial outlook for Bajaj Finance is optimistic, with a projected 18.1% increase in net profit, rising to ₹4,518 crore compared to ₹3,825 crore during the same quarter last year. Additionally, net interest income (NII) is anticipated to climb 23%, reaching ₹9,814 crore, bolstered by significant loan book expansion.
Key Financial Metrics
- Net Profit: Expected to grow to ₹4,518 crore (up 18.1% YoY)
- Net Interest Income: Projected at ₹9,814 crore (up 23% YoY)
- Margins: Forecasted to contract by 5 basis points to 9.65%
- Credit Costs: Expected to decrease by 5 basis points to 2.05%
Should Investors Consider Buying Bajaj Finance Shares?
Year-to-date, Bajaj Finance shares have surged over 21%, with a remarkable 30% increase in the past year and an impressive 113% return over the last five years.
Market Analysis
Analysts remain bullish on Bajaj Finance’s stock, noting that it has recently broken out after a four-year consolidation phase. Ruchit Jain, Vice President of Equity Technical Research at Motilal Oswal Financial Services, suggests that the prevailing trend is favorable, encouraging a "buy on dips" strategy. He notes a solid support level between ₹8,600 and ₹8,700, with potential targets of ₹9,600 to ₹9,700.
As of 10:15 AM, Bajaj Finance shares were trading 0.86% lower at ₹9,013.50. Investors and analysts alike are poised for today’s financial announcement, eager to see if the company meets or exceeds expectations.
